Health Care Alert: Navigating Health Care Reform (September 17, 2010)
New Guidance on Internal Claims Procedures and External Reviews Under PPACA Might Be the Best Reason to Maintain Grandfathered Plan Status
September 17, 2010
Section 2719 of the Public Health Service Act ("PHS Act"), which was added by the Patient Protection and Affordable Care Act as amended by the Health Care and Education Reconciliation Act of 2010 (collectively, the "Act"), sets forth standards for both internal claims and appeals and external review processes. The standards apply to group health plans and issuers offering individual and group policies, but do not apply to grandfathered plans or policies or excepted benefits under the Health Insurance Portability and Accountability Act of 1996 (e.g., stand-alone dental and vision plans and certain health flexible spending accounts), and retiree-only plans.
